Transaction 4bf65590bfec716e48138268abeffa31acb42e2696826dc1f42dbbdf633904c8

2 Input
2 Outputs
  • 4bf65590bfec716e48138268abeffa31acb42e2696826dc1f42dbbdf633904c8:0
  • value  27492679
    address  1DgcYMgUXfd5Lwuv1wEzsQGGkV3zxFWEvu
  • 4bf65590bfec716e48138268abeffa31acb42e2696826dc1f42dbbdf633904c8:1
  • value  7830061
    address  1LL8QzNCUKDyKNvNznro98Sk9uPnzTDuab